2025年10月8日 9:00現在、解決しているようです。シンプルに、
irm https://claude.ai/install.ps1 | iex
コマンドを実行し、Windowsも再起動(念のため)すると直ると思います。Claude Codeのバージョンは、2.0.10 になります
2025年10月7日に、一部のWindowsでネイティブインストールしたClaude Codeを使っている方々から「エラーが起こっている」という相談を受けました。
私たちのように、エンジニアではない人間にとっての一番おすすめの解決方法は、
解決を見守る、応援する(問題報告、寄付)・・・つまり待つ
対応が行われたら、アップデート
です。
2025年10月8日 9:00現在
解決方法は、以下のとおりです。
(1) PowerShellを起動
(2) 以下のコマンドを実行(Visual Studio Codeの中ではなく、単独でPowerShellを起動し、実行してください。その方が確実)
irm https://claude.ai/install.ps1 | iex
(3) Windowsの再起動(しなくても良いと思うが、念のために)
Claude Codeのバージョンが、2.0.10 以後になったら解決します(少なくとも僕の環境では)
普遍的な解決方法
(1) アップデート情報をチェック
まず、アップデート情報をチェックします。
こんなバグや、エラーを解決したよ!って情報が載って、バージョンアップが行われたら、バージョンアップのチャンスです!
(2) アップデート方法
Windows ネイティブのClaude Codeのアップデートは、以下のコマンドで行うと確実です。つまり、再インストールになります。
irm https://claude.ai/install.ps1 | iex
今回のエラーは、claude が立ち上がらないという状態だったので、claude upgrade などのコマンドが実行できません。そこで、シンプルに「再インストール」を実行します。
今回の問題について
ちなみに、エラー内容は、以下のようなものでした(相談者さんから送られたもの)。
PS C:\Users\USER\workspace\practice\beautiful_Earth> claude
============================================================
Bun v1.2.23 (cf136713) Windows x64 (baseline)
Windows v.win11_dt
CPU: sse42 avx avx2
Args: “C:\Users\USER\.local\bin\claude.exe”
Features: Bun.stderr(2) Bun.stdin(2) Bun.stdout(2) dotenv jsc spawn standalone_executable
Builtins: “bun:main” “node:assert” “node:async_hooks” “node:buffer” “node:child_process” “node:constants” “node:crypto” “node:domain” “node:events” “node:fs” “node:fs/promises” “node:http” “node:https” “node:module” “node:net” “node:os” “node:path” “node:path/win32” “node:perf_hooks” “node:process” “node:querystring” “node:stream” “node:string_decoder” “node:timers/promises” “node:tls” “node:tty” “node:url” “node:util” “node:zlib” “undici” “ws” “node-fetch” “node:inspector” “node:http2”
Elapsed: 1167ms | User: 968ms | Sys: 203ms
RSS: 0.30GB | Peak: 0.31GB | Commit: 0.39GB | Faults: 77993 | Machine: 8.45GB
panic(main thread): Unexpected error
ENOTCONN: Transport endpoint is not connected (open())
oh no: Bun has crashed. This indicates a bug in Bun, not your code.
To send a redacted crash report to Bun’s team,
please file a GitHub issue using the link below:
https://bun.report/1.2.23/(ここにGithub Issueへ投稿するためのリンク)
エラーの詳細をチェックする方法
怖いもの見たさ(学ぶ力を高める)で、調査するのは非常に重要です。上記のメッセージを読んで推測したり、Claude.ai にメッセージを貼り付け、内容の意味を教えてもらうと「Bun」というツールのエラーに起因しているとわかります。
なお、最新のこの手のエラーの解決をClaude.ai や、ChatGPTに頼んでも、間違った返答が返ってくることが多いです。正しい情報を返してもらうには、「コンテキスト情報」を与えてあげる必要があります。
例えば、
現在は、2025年10月7日です
Windows 11 XXX を使っています
Claudeのバージョンは XXXX です
Claude Codeは、WSL版ではなく、ネイティブ版です
Cluadeは、「・・・」というコマンドを使って、最新バージョン XXXX にしています
参考にしたインストール方法は、(ここにURL)です
とした上で、
「関連しそうなツール、Githubの活動などを最新の動向をチェックし、どうすれば解決しそうか教えてください」
ぐらいにしないと、良い回答が得られないです。ちなみに、ちゃんと情報を入れてあげると、「あなたのBunは最新バージョンですね。現在、同様の問題が報告されているようです。解決するまで待つか、ダウングレードすると良いです」みたいな回答が得られました。
AIの仕組み(知識のカットオフ、コンテキスト情報、出力は予測という仕組みの高度版であるというメンタルモデルを持つこと)が、とても大切です。